Security through obscurity is really stupid and dangerous. OS's are not targets, but people and companies are (given enough value on the system, intrudes will surely take the time to investigate Haiku). Moreover, entire classes of attacks are OS agnostic, but OS's can protect against them. Finally, to become worthwhile, Haiku must be secure ;) Best wishes, - wpc
